Output dbda626220a61863fa94a3e269a3b0dd17f0783e2c68a1200bf28e7f39306469:0

value
17386626
script pubkey
OP_0 OP_PUSHBYTES_20 e58ffb5d523789d009e2754c32ba6115ed891706
address
ltc1quk8lkh2jx7yaqz0zw4xr9wnpzhkcj9cx36v503
transaction
dbda626220a61863fa94a3e269a3b0dd17f0783e2c68a1200bf28e7f39306469
spent
true